WebOct 1, 2015 · It’s a Latin word derived from the roots lux (light) and ferre (to carry). It means “light bearer” or “light bringer,” and it was not originally used in connection with the devil. Instead, it could be used multiple ways. For example, anybody carrying a torch at night was a lucifer (light bringer). It was also used as a name for the ... WebIn Greek it's "heosphoros," "light-bearer." In Latin it's translated "Lucifer," light-bearer. Whether you say "heylel," "heosphoros" or "lucifer," the meaning is the same: "light-bearer." But only Lucifer communicates who we are talking about in English. And not only English uses the term. Look at these ancient translations of the word. The Latin word "Lucifer" is made up from two (2) Latin words. These two (2) words are: Lux (=light) + ferous (= to bear or carry). Thus the name "Lucifer" means in the Latin language "Light-bearer" or "Light-bringer".
